Output 66aa972badb83739e348d65f6dc3d2f1584ec56662b851e53dafedac4e2c6dd1:153

value
99500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 068d2a8621dcea04543787d375a5f319c4fc2994 OP_EQUAL
address
32Hf6648vLXYYHaTqVJ41LDewB2xnwbr96
transaction
66aa972badb83739e348d65f6dc3d2f1584ec56662b851e53dafedac4e2c6dd1
spent
true